3. You are given the following information about a bond: (i) Par value is 1000. (ii) Redemption value is 1000. (iii) Coupon rate 12%, convertible semi-annually. (iv) It is priced to yield 10%, convertible semi-annually. The bond has a term of n years. If the term of the bond is doubled, the price will increase by 50. Calculate the price of the n year bond.
